Building codes and regulations are important parts that each building contractor ought to be intimately conversant in (Kitchen Remodeling Contractor Los Angeles). These codes serve as guidelines to make sure security, well being, and welfare of the basic public in the realm of construction and development. Ignoring or failing to comply with updated codes can result in fines, project delays, and even severe authorized ramifications.


Construction codes encompass all kinds of areas including structural design, plumbing, electrical installations, hearth and safety measures, and accessibility requirements. Each jurisdiction might have its personal particular codes, influenced by local local weather, geography, and social needs. Therefore, understanding how these codes apply at an area stage is crucial for contractors.


One main space of focus within constructing codes is structural integrity. Compliance ensures that buildings can withstand numerous forces such as wind, snow, and seismic activity. This is especially vital in areas vulnerable to natural disasters. Knowledge of structural codes helps in designing buildings that aren't solely aesthetically pleasing but in addition secure and sturdy.

Plumbing and electrical codes are equally important. These laws set standards for installations to forestall hazards such as leaks, electrical shorts, or fires. Familiarity with these codes permits contractors to execute designs efficiently whereas minimizing risks related to utilities. This information extends to understanding the types of supplies and components that are permissible.


Fire security codes are important in safeguarding lives. These codes specify necessities for fireplace alarms, extinguishers, escape routes, and material choice. Contractors should pay attention to these regulations to ensure that buildings present secure technique of egress in emergencies. Noncompliance can result in catastrophic outcomes, highlighting the significance of thorough information.


Energy effectivity is one other important side of contemporary building codes. Many jurisdictions are implementing stricter laws to advertise sustainable practices. Understanding vitality codes permits contractors to recommend building supplies and techniques that reduce energy consumption. Implementing these codes not only benefits the surroundings however can also result in value savings for building house owners.


Accessibility codes are designed to make sure equal entry for all people, together with these with disabilities. The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A) in the United States is an example of legislation that outlines specific requirements. Contractors must know these guidelines to create spaces that accommodate everyone, avoiding potential discrimination claims.

Documentation is commonly a critical component of compliance. Builders should submit plans for approval, which must adhere to native codes. This documentation serves as a report that safety and regulatory requirements have been considered through the planning and building phases. Failure to take care of proper documentation can lead to severe penalties, together with pressured alterations or demolitions.


Inspections are one other core part of building. Local government officers sometimes conduct these inspections to make sure compliance with building codes. Understanding the inspection process helps contractors put together and manage their work methods. It also offers a possibility to rectify any points before the final evaluation, saving money and time.


Continuing training is important in this field. Codes evolve due to developments in expertise, supplies, and societal wants. Staying updated with the newest modifications ensures that contractors aren't left behind. Workshops, seminars, and on-line programs can be found to assist professionals hold their knowledge current.


Networking with local officials view and other industry professionals also can provide useful insights. Many municipalities hold regular meetings or forums to discuss modifications in codes and laws. Participating in these gatherings can supply contractors a chance to advocate for clearer codes or voice considerations about compliance issues.

The monetary facet cannot be missed. Compliance with building codes can initially appear burdensome as a end result of costs related to permits, inspections, and supplies. However, the long-term benefits of adhering to these regulations—such as lowering liability, rising resale value, and enhancing reputation—far outweigh the preliminary expenditures.


In conclusion, understanding building codes and rules is indispensable for any construction contractor. This data not only ensures that tasks meet security and design rules but additionally fosters a culture of belief and professionalism within the business. Whether coping with structural integrity, plumbing, fire safety, or accessibility, each aspect of development is intertwined with compliance. Thus, being equipped with up-to-date info and a stable understanding of these codes can significantly impression a contractor's success. By prioritizing this knowledge, contractors can build safer, extra efficient, and more inclusive buildings that contribute positively to communities and the setting.

Why are building codes essential for contractors?


Building codes are essential for contractors as they help be sure that building tasks meet safety requirements, which protects each employees and future occupants. Compliance with these codes additionally shields contractors from legal liabilities and potential fines.

How can I discover out what building codes apply to my project?


To decide the relevant building codes, you should consult your local building division or planning office. They can present info on specific codes, zoning legal guidelines, and any permits required for your project.

Are building codes the identical everywhere?


Building codes can differ significantly by location. Each state, and sometimes individual municipalities, has its own constructing codes, which may be primarily based on nationwide standards however can embrace local amendments that tackle specific regional issues.

What role do national standards play in local building codes?


National standards, such as these set by the International Code Council (ICC), function the muse for many native constructing codes. Local jurisdictions could undertake these requirements with modifications to cater to particular native circumstances or practices.
